Internet applications

Ubuntu includes a collection of world-class Internet applications to make your on-line experience as effortless as possible.

Firefox Web Browser

Firefox is an award-winning browser which allows you to enjoy the web comfortably and securely. With many novel features, such as live bookmarks, integrated search and tabbed-browsing, Firefox offers one of the best browsing experiences available.

To start the Firefox Web Browser, press ApplicationsInternetFirefox Web Browser, or press the blue globe icon at the top of your screen.

Evolution Mail

Evolution is an easy-to-use personal organizer, which is the default email application in Ubuntu. It offers a pleasing mix of advanced features and ease of use, designed to keep yourself and your emails organized. Whether you want to keep track of your tasks and appointments or just send and receive email, Evolution is a great choice.

To start Evolution Mail, press ApplicationsInternetEvolution Mail.

Gaim Internet Messenger

Gaim is an instant messaging application with a twist - it allows you to talk to your friends and contacts on all of the major instant messaging networks, such as AIM and MSN, at the same time. While advanced features are not available for some networks, Gaim does a great job of allowing you to chat with your buddies.

To start the Gaim Instant Messenger, press ApplicationsInternetGaim Instant Messenger.

Optional applications

A wide range of excellent Internet software is available for use with Ubuntu, including these examples:

  • Liferea Feed Reader - allows you to collect and read Internet news feeds

  • Ekiga Softphone - make free phone calls over the Internet

  • Drivel Journal Editor - publish your very own online diary (blog)
